Hair damage is an inevitable consequence of heat styling, chemical processing, and environmental stress, but recent scientific advances have given us powerful tools to reverse this damage at a molecular level. The breakthrough lies in bond repair technology, which focuses on rebuilding the three types of bonds that give hair its strength and elasticity: disulphide bonds, hydrogen bonds, and salt bonds. Disulphide bonds, in particular, are the strongest and most susceptible to breakage from bleaching and perming. New treatments, such as those containing bis‑aminopropyl diglycol dimaleate (found in popular bond‑repair systems), work by penetrating the cortex and forming new disulphide bonds between broken keratin chains, effectively ‘gluing’ the hair back together. This process not only restores tensile strength but also improves elasticity and reduces porosity, leading to noticeably smoother, shinier hair that resists future damage. The latest generation of bond‑repair products are designed to be used in multiple steps – a pre‑treatment primer, a bonding shampoo, and a leave‑in serum – each contributing to cumulative repair over time. Clinical studies have shown that consistent use can increase hair’s breaking point by up to 50% after just a few applications. Moreover, these treatments are now being formulated with additional nourishing ingredients like hyaluronic acid and ceramides to hydrate and seal the cuticle, addressing both internal and external health. It is important to note that bond repair is not a miracle cure – it works best on mildly to moderately damaged hair, and severely over‑processed hair may still require trimming. However, for most people, these treatments can transform dull, fragile strands into resilient, glossy tresses.
